Output 679044e889f846234c05817e9a05b2f30572db63e7813577bee6aa217570c7b7:3

value
3251816
script pubkey
OP_0 OP_PUSHBYTES_20 077cdc84bcc5e8ae1d4031483559268668fec48a
address
bc1qqa7dep9uch52u82qx9yr2kfxse50a3y2xnuxzz
transaction
679044e889f846234c05817e9a05b2f30572db63e7813577bee6aa217570c7b7
spent
true